This is an example of a between-subjects factorial design.
Explanation:
In a between-subjects factorial design, all of the independent variables are manipulated between subjects.

In the
appraisal process, the fourth and fifth steps afford managers the chance to
offer constructive criticism and corrective feedback to their employees, and to
also get feedback from them. The fourth step of the performance evaluation
process is to discuss results with the employee, while the fifth step is about
taking corrective action.
